Bluetooth Beacon Basics: Understand beacons, small devices emitting Bluetooth signals for proximity-based ads
Bluetooth beacons are small, battery-powered devices that emit Bluetooth signals at regular intervals, enabling proximity-based marketing. These signals are picked up by nearby smartphones or tablets with Bluetooth enabled, triggering location-specific actions such as push notifications, app alerts, or coupon offers. Beacons operate on Bluetooth Low Energy (BLE) technology, ensuring minimal power consumption while maintaining a range of up to 70 meters, depending on environmental factors like walls or interference. Their compact size—often no larger than a coin—makes them discreet and easy to deploy in retail stores, museums, airports, and other public spaces.
To implement beacon-based advertising, businesses first need to install beacons strategically in high-traffic areas. For instance, a retail store might place beacons near product displays or entrances to engage customers with relevant promotions. Next, users must have a compatible app installed on their device, as beacons rely on software to interpret signals and deliver content. Marketers can customize messages based on user behavior, such as offering a discount to a customer who has spent more than 5 minutes near a specific product. Analytics tools integrated with beacon systems provide insights into foot traffic, dwell time, and conversion rates, allowing for data-driven optimizations.
One of the key advantages of beacons is their ability to deliver hyper-localized content, creating a personalized experience for users. For example, a museum could use beacons to send visitors information about the exhibit they’re standing in front of, enhancing engagement. However, success hinges on user opt-in; consumers must enable Bluetooth and location services on their devices, and businesses must ensure compliance with privacy regulations like GDPR. Clear communication about the benefits of opting in, such as exclusive discounts or tailored recommendations, can encourage participation.
Despite their potential, beacons are not a one-size-fits-all solution. Their effectiveness depends on factors like user adoption, app integration, and creative content strategy. For instance, a poorly designed notification may be ignored or perceived as intrusive. Businesses should test beacon campaigns with small audiences to refine messaging and placement before scaling. Additionally, combining beacons with other technologies, such as Wi-Fi or geofencing, can enhance targeting accuracy and provide a more seamless user experience.

Location-Based Targeting: Use Bluetooth to deliver ads based on user location and movement
Bluetooth technology, with its ability to connect devices over short distances, has evolved beyond mere file transfers and wireless headphones. One of its most innovative applications in advertising is location-based targeting, where ads are delivered to users based on their precise location and movement patterns. This approach leverages Bluetooth beacons—small, battery-powered devices that emit signals to nearby smartphones—to create hyper-localized marketing campaigns. For instance, a retail store can place beacons near its entrance to send promotions or product recommendations directly to shoppers’ phones as they walk in, creating a seamless and personalized shopping experience.
To implement location-based targeting effectively, start by mapping your physical space with Bluetooth beacons. Place these devices strategically in high-traffic areas, such as store entrances, product displays, or checkout counters. Each beacon broadcasts a unique ID, which a user’s smartphone detects via a compatible app. When the app recognizes the beacon’s signal, it triggers a pre-programmed action, like displaying a discount offer or suggesting complementary products. For example, a grocery store could place beacons near the bakery section to send fresh bread promotions to nearby customers, increasing impulse purchases.
However, privacy concerns must be addressed to build trust with users. Always ensure that your app requires explicit opt-in consent for location-based ads. Transparency is key—clearly explain how the data will be used and provide an easy opt-out option. Additionally, limit data collection to what’s necessary for the campaign. For instance, instead of tracking users’ entire movement history, focus on real-time interactions within your store. This approach not only respects user privacy but also enhances the relevance of your ads, making them more effective.

Personalized Messaging: Tailor ads to individual preferences via Bluetooth-connected devices
Bluetooth technology has evolved beyond mere file transfers and wireless headphones, becoming a powerful tool for hyper-personalized advertising. By leveraging Bluetooth-connected devices, marketers can now deliver tailored messages directly to consumers based on their preferences, behaviors, and location. This approach transforms generic ads into meaningful interactions, increasing engagement and conversion rates. For instance, a retail store could send a 15% discount on running shoes to a customer whose fitness tracker indicates frequent jogging, creating a sense of relevance and urgency.
To implement personalized messaging via Bluetooth, start by integrating Bluetooth beacons in strategic locations—stores, malls, or events. These beacons detect nearby devices and collect anonymized data, such as device IDs and dwell time. Pair this with a customer database that maps preferences to device profiles. For example, if a user frequently searches for vegan products online, the system can flag their device for plant-based food promotions. Ensure compliance with privacy regulations like GDPR by obtaining explicit consent and offering opt-out options. Tools like Google’s Eddystone or Apple’s iBeacon frameworks simplify beacon deployment and data management.
The effectiveness of personalized Bluetooth ads lies in their ability to bridge the physical and digital worlds. Imagine a museum visitor receiving audio descriptions of exhibits based on their language preference or a festival-goer getting stage schedules tailored to their favorite genres. However, success hinges on balancing personalization with non-intrusiveness. Overloading users with frequent notifications can lead to opt-outs. Limit messages to 2–3 per visit and ensure they provide clear value, such as exclusive discounts or time-sensitive offers. A/B testing can help refine timing, content, and frequency for optimal results.
One cautionary note: Bluetooth-based advertising requires careful consideration of battery life and user experience. Constantly scanning for beacons can drain smartphone batteries, so optimize beacon settings to minimize energy consumption. Additionally, not all consumers have Bluetooth enabled, so complement this strategy with other channels like Wi-Fi or QR codes. For older demographics (50+), who may be less tech-savvy, pair Bluetooth ads with clear instructions on how to enable the feature or access promotions offline.

Analytics & Tracking: Measure ad engagement and user behavior using Bluetooth data
Bluetooth technology offers a unique opportunity to measure ad engagement and user behavior in ways that traditional digital analytics cannot. By leveraging Bluetooth beacons, advertisers can track real-world interactions with ads placed in physical locations, such as billboards, posters, or in-store displays. These beacons emit signals that nearby smartphones can detect, enabling the collection of anonymized data on user proximity, dwell time, and frequency of visits. This granular insight bridges the gap between offline advertising and measurable outcomes, providing a clearer picture of how physical ads influence consumer behavior.
To implement Bluetooth-based analytics, start by deploying beacons near your advertisements. Ensure the beacons are strategically placed to maximize signal reach without interfering with other devices. Next, integrate a compatible app or SDK into your campaign to capture data from users who have Bluetooth enabled and permissions granted. For example, a retail store could place beacons near a promotional display and track how many passersby stopped to engage with the ad for more than 10 seconds. This data can then be correlated with in-store purchases to evaluate ad effectiveness.
One of the key advantages of Bluetooth tracking is its ability to provide contextually rich data. Unlike online ads, which rely on clicks and impressions, Bluetooth analytics can reveal how long a user lingered near an ad, how often they returned, and whether they moved closer to the advertised product. For instance, a museum could use beacons to track visitor engagement with exhibit signage, identifying which displays attracted the most attention and for how long. This data can inform future exhibit design and placement strategies.
However, privacy concerns must be addressed when using Bluetooth for tracking. Always ensure compliance with regulations like GDPR and obtain explicit user consent where required. Anonymize data to protect individual identities, and be transparent about how the information is collected and used. For example, a shopping mall using Bluetooth beacons could notify visitors via signage and provide an opt-out option in their mobile app. Balancing data collection with user privacy builds trust and ensures long-term acceptance of the technology.

Privacy & Compliance: Ensure Bluetooth ad campaigns adhere to data privacy regulations
Bluetooth advertising, while innovative, treads a fine line between engagement and intrusion. Data privacy regulations like GDPR, CCPA, and others mandate strict adherence to user consent and data protection. Ignoring these can lead to hefty fines, reputational damage, and loss of consumer trust. For instance, GDPR fines can reach up to €20 million or 4% of annual global turnover, whichever is higher. Thus, ensuring compliance isn’t just ethical—it’s a legal and financial imperative.
To navigate this landscape, start by implementing explicit opt-in mechanisms. Unlike Wi-Fi or cellular data, Bluetooth advertising often relies on proximity-based interactions, making it crucial to secure user consent before collecting or processing any data. Use clear, concise language in your prompts, avoiding technical jargon. For example, a pop-up message like, "Allow [Brand Name] to send you personalized offers via Bluetooth?" with a simple "Yes" or "No" option ensures transparency and compliance. Avoid pre-ticked boxes or passive opt-ins, as these violate regulations like GDPR.
Next, minimize data collection and storage. Bluetooth advertising doesn’t require extensive personal information to be effective. Limit data gathering to what’s strictly necessary—such as device IDs for campaign analytics—and anonymize it whenever possible. For instance, instead of storing full MAC addresses, use hashed or truncated versions. Additionally, set clear retention periods for collected data, deleting it once its purpose is fulfilled. This not only aligns with privacy regulations but also reduces the risk of data breaches.
Finally, conduct regular audits and stay updated on regulatory changes. Data privacy laws evolve rapidly, and what’s compliant today may not be tomorrow. Assign a dedicated compliance officer or team to monitor updates and ensure your Bluetooth ad campaigns remain aligned with current standards. Tools like Data Protection Impact Assessments (DPIAs) can help identify and mitigate risks proactively. By treating compliance as an ongoing process rather than a one-time task, you safeguard both your brand and your customers’ trust.

Bluetooth advertising allows devices to broadcast small packets of data to nearby Bluetooth-enabled devices without requiring pairing. It uses Bluetooth Low Energy (BLE) technology to send promotional content, notifications, or information to users within a specific range.
To create a Bluetooth advertisement campaign, you’ll need a Bluetooth beacon or device capable of broadcasting BLE signals. Use a platform or SDK to design and encode your message, set the broadcast range, and deploy the beacons in strategic locations to reach your target audience.
Bluetooth advertisements can include text messages, URLs, app notifications, coupons, or location-based information. The content is limited in size due to BLE’s small payload capacity, so it’s best to keep messages concise and actionable.
Bluetooth advertising is most effective for localized, proximity-based campaigns, such as in-store promotions or event notifications. While it may not reach a global audience, it excels in engaging users in specific areas with relevant, timely content.
Bluetooth advertisements do not collect personal data unless users interact with the content (e.g., clicking a link or downloading an app). However, users can disable Bluetooth on their devices to avoid receiving unsolicited advertisements, and businesses should ensure compliance with privacy regulations.
